British Columbia's Conservatives named Trevor Halford interim leader after John Rustad resigned amid a leadership crisis.
The British Columbia Conservative Party appointed Trevor Halford as interim leader in December 2024 after 20 MLAs lost confidence in John Rustad, triggering a standoff when Rustad refused to step down despite being deemed "professionally incapacitated."
Rustad resigned the next day to prevent a party split.
Halford, emphasizing unity and resilience, highlighted improved fundraising and membership growth, stressing the need to focus on British Columbians' struggles with healthcare, housing, and property rights.
The upcoming leadership race aims to unify the party and clarify its direction, including the future of five former Conservatives now sitting as Independents.
